Feeling Exhausted, Numb, or Like You're Just Going Through the Motions? You're Not Alone

Burnout does not always look like collapse. More often it looks like showing up every day while feeling emptier inside, snapping at people you love, dreading work you used to enjoy, or feeling like no amount of rest actually restores you. Many people in Lethbridge, especially those in demanding jobs or caregiving roles, push through burnout for months before recognizing it for what it is. You do not have to wait for a breaking point. Frequently Asked Questions About Burnout Therapy

Burnout is more than ordinary tiredness. It tends to involve prolonged emotional exhaustion, a sense of detachment or cynicism about work or caregiving, and a drop in your usual effectiveness that doesn't improve with a weekend off or a vacation. If you have felt this way for weeks or months, it is worth talking to someone.
